About Peter Tom Jones
Peter Tom Jones is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Biomedical Engineering, Materials Chemistry,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ering and Civil and Structural Engineering, having authored 141 papers that have together received 7.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Metallurgical Processes and Thermodynamics (63 papers), Extraction and Separation Processes (26 papers), Metal Extraction and Bioleaching (22 papers), Iron and Steelmaking Processes (20 papers), Materials Engineering and Processing (18 papers), Concrete and Cement Materials Research (16 papers), Advanced materials and composites (13 papers) and Recycling and Waste Management Techniques (13 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ering (1.9k citations), Geochemistry and Petrology (1.1k citations), Mechanical Engineering (5.0k citations), Ceramics and Composites (364 citations) and Building and Construction (813 citations). Peter Tom Jones has collaborated with scholars based in Belgium, Canada and United States. Frequent co-authors include Koen Binnemans, Bart Blanpain, Tom Van Gerven, Allan Walton, Matthias Buchert, Yongxiang Yang, Yiannis Pontikes, Patrick Wollants, Muxing Guo and Daneel Geysen.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Sustainable Metallurgy, Journal of the European Ceramic Society, ISIJ International, Metallurgical and Materials Transactions B and Journal of Cleaner Production.
